Fully customizable Web CMS Development Project

Code and documentation of Fully customizable Web CMS Development Project

Category

Web Application

Introduction

Web content management (WCM) systems allow users to create, edit, and publish digital content such as web pages, content slider element for web pages, embedded URLs, text, embedded audio and video files, and interactive graphics for websites. For users that do not have coding skills, these systems make the process of uploading and writing content simple by offering theme-oriented templates for unique design.

WCM systems are generally used in collaborative scenarios where multiple team members can manage web content and with our prior coding knowledge they are able to create new web pages for their website.

Our WCM is for a Tourism company. We must create a WCMS along its Website. Our WCMS will provide A-Z Customization i.e Full CRUD operations, post creations Web page creation from WCMS each type of content which will be use in front end will be uploaded via WCMS.

Functional Requirements:

Website Development.

WCMS Development using CodeIgniter or Laravel Framework only.

Website Development:

  1. Slider based Home Page:
  2. About Us Page:
  3. Tours Page:
  4. Customize Tour Form Page:
  5. Services Page:
  6. Get Quote Form Page:
  7. Contact Us Form Page

WCMS Development:

Create a WCMS, each element of website will be created and managed by WCMS. i.e. website pages mentioned above and the content for them will be created and upload from WCMS. Add/Delete/update Web Page.

Content Upload and Delete.

Form View for form pages i.e., Contact us form page etc.

Tools and technologies:

Laravel/CodeIgniter Php Frameworks only.

PHP, Sublime Text, Xampp, Bootstrap, MySQL

Class diagram, activity diagram, data flow diagram, sequence diagram, use case diagram, Use case description, scope, hard requirements, non-functional requirements, testing test cases, SRS document, design manual, and other diagrams are needed to draw for this project.Project